WebSelect Start , type services, and select Services. In the Name column, right-click (or long-press) on the Touch Keyboard and Handwriting Panel Service and select Properties. Change Startup type to Automatic, then select Start. Select Apply, then OK. Restart your device to ensure the change takes effect. WebJun 29, 2024 · This video will show you how to enable and disable your touchscreen device in Windows 10. Use the following steps to enable and disable your touchscreen: Press Windows key + X. Select Device Manager. Find HID-Compliant touchscreen under Human Interface Devices. Right-click the device name and select Disable or Enable.

WebType and search [Device Manager] in the Windows search bar①, then click on [Open]②. Check on the arrow next to [Human Interface Devices]③, then right-click on [HID-compliant touch screen]④ and select [Enable device]⑤.
